Stictocardia sivarajanii
|
|
|
|
Family:
CONVOLVULACEAE
|
|
Citation: Stictocardia sivarajanii Biju, Pushpangadan & Mathew, Novon 9: 147. 1999.

Description:
Perennials, stem woody at base, trailing or twinning, terete, herbaceous towards tip, pubescent; latex colorless, gummy. Leaves simple, alternate, 4-20 x 3-17 cm, ovate to ovate-deltoid, apically acuminate and shortly mucronulate, basally cordate, sparsely pubescent above, young leaf with dorsal side purplish violet, pubescent or tomentose below, covered with minute black glands; midrib and lateral veins raised beneath; lateral veins 8-13 pairs; petiole up to 10 cm long, pubescent, younger ones tomentose. Flowers axillary, solitary or in 2-3 flowered cymes; peduncle up to 15 cm long, terete to angular, pubescent, mostly longer than petiole; bracts 2, ovate-elliptic, small, 5-8 x 2-3 mm, apically acute to slightly acuminate, pubescent outside, glabrous within; pedicels up to 2-4 cm long, pubescent, angled and enlarged in fruits. Sepals 5, subequal, outer 2 larger, 1-1.2 x 0.7-0.9 cm, widely ovate to orbicular, apically obtuse to emarginate, densely black glandular on both sides, sparsely pubescent, middle 2 medium-sized, 0.8-1 x 0.5-0.6 cm, broadly ovate-elliptic, apically emarginate and shortly apiculate, glandular dotted, glabrous to puberulent outside, innermost one small, 0.6-0.8 x 0.3-0.4 cm, suborbicular, apically emarginate and shortly apiculate, glandular dotted, glabrous. Corolla reddish purple with a darker center, funnel shaped, tube up to 3.5 cm long, limb slightly 5-lobed, 5-7 cm across, mid petaline bands glabrous and with minute black glands. Stamens inserted; anthers up to 7 mm long, straight after dehiscence; filaments attached up to 5 mm above the corolla base, 2 long, up to 2.5 cm, 3 short, up to 2.1 cm long, filiform, purplish red ciliolate at dilated base; disc small, ± 1 mm long, annular, slightly lobed. Ovary conical, 1.2 x 2 mm, glabrous, 4-celled; style subexserted, up to 3.5-3.7 cm long, glabrous, filiform, stigma biglobose, papillose. Fruits capsular, indehiscent, depressed globose, not 4-lobed, 1-1.8 x 0.8-1.2 cm, glabrous, not engulfed by the enlarged sepals, which are striate cartilaginous, 1.3-1.6 x 1.4-2 cm; seeds 1-4, globose, 6-8 x 6-7 mm, covered with minute hairs, sparsely pubescent at hilum.

Habit:
Climber
|
|
Flowering & Fruiting:
October-February
|
|
District(s):
Idukki
|
|
Medicinal:
|
|
Habitat:
Evergreen forests
|
|
Distribution:
Southern Western Ghats
